Simon Cathro was appointed as Voluntary Administrator of six companies (NRH, NRP, AHA, HPIP, HPIA and Ce'Nedra) on 27 August 2008. Subsequently, on 12 December 2008, Simon Cathro and David Lombe were appointed Liquidators by resolution of the respective creditors of each of the companies (NRH, NRP, AHA, HPIP, HPIA and Ce'Nedra). Simon Cathro and David Lombe were also appointed as Official Liquidators of SPAC on 15 December 2008 after a successful winding up petition by Ce'Nedra. In addition, David Winterbottom and Robert William Hutson of KordaMentha were appointed as Receivers and Managers of the REAL Group on 14 May 2008. These companies were Australian subsidiaries of Real Estate Assets Limited a New Zealand based company. Prior to the Voluntary Administration and Receivership the REAL Group was running three hotels in Australia under the "Courtyard by Marriott" brand. The REAL Group's hotels were as follows;
The Receivers continued to trade the businesses and advertised the businesses for sale. The Receivers subsequently sold the Surfers Paradise Hotel (November 2008) and the North Ryde Hotel (December 2008) before handing control of the Parramatta Hotel over to the Liquidators on 1 April 2010. The Liquidators subsequently sold the Parramatta Hotel on 18 October 2010. The Liquidators are currently finalising some outstanding legal matters so that the Liquidations can be finalised and a dividend paid where appropriate. |
